Analysis

The most recent figure for hungary — industrial roundwood, coniferous (export/import) — export in Croatia is 2 1000 USD, measured in 2018. That is the lowest value across all 9 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 93.8% on the previous year and down 98.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, hungary — industrial roundwood, coniferous (export/import) — export in Croatia peaked at 168 1000 USD in 2008 and was at its lowest, 2 1000 USD, in 2018.

Croatia ranks 16th of 21 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
